基于区域锐度的多聚焦图像融合

摘要: 为了获得同一场景内所有物体都清晰的图像,提出一种新的多聚焦图像融合算法。把待融合图像进行分块,构造融合块的清晰度评价函数(区域锐度),根据其区域锐度值,判断融合块应取自哪幅源图像。采用投票选举的方法对融合图像进行一致性校验,对相邻但来自不同聚焦图像的融合块进行加权融合。实验结果证明,与基于小波分解的融合算法相比,该算法速度快、效果好。

关键词: 图像融合, 多聚焦图像, 清晰度, 区域锐度

Abstract: In order to get a clear image that contains all relevant objects in an area, this paper proposes a new multi-focus image fusion algorithm. It divides the candidate images into small blocks, and constructs the blocks region acutance function to evaluate image definition. What source images the fused block obtains from depends on the region acutance value of the corresponding block. In the endgame, consistency of the fused images is verified by means of voting, and the adjacent blocks from different candidate images are weighted and fused. Experimental results prove that this algorithm is faster and more precise than traditional wavelet-based fusion.


Key words: image fusion, multi-focus image, definition, region acutance
